Problem
Manual evaluation of patent claim scope is time-consuming and limited in scope, requiring significant effort from skilled professionals to determine the breadth of claims in patents or patent applications.
Innovation Solution
A system and method for automatically analyzing and evaluating the claim scope breadth of patents or patent applications using a user interface for selecting patents and applying search algorithms to determine prior art and calculate scope breadth, enabling quick and easy analysis without manual reading and construal.

Systems and methods for calculating a patent claim scope rating are disclosed. In an example embodiment, a method of calculating a patent claim scope rating includes identifying patent references cited in examination of a subject patent and storing the identified patent references as an applied art list, identifying first backward references for the patent references in the applied art list and storing the first backward references as a first backward list, identifying second backward references for the first backward references in the first backward list and storing the second backward references as a second backward list, identifying forward references for the patent references in the applied art list and storing the forward references as a forward list. A patent claim scope rating is based on a calculation including at least a partial combination listing of the applied art list, the first and second backward lists, and the forward list.
